UDC is seeking a Technical Business Architect
who will lead cross-functional utility modernization programs with a strong emphasis on GIS integration, business process transformation, and enterprise systems alignment.
We anticipate business travel 3-4 weeks/month to support our Bay Area client, however this can vary depending on client and project requirements.
This hybrid role combines business strategy, technical expertise, and program delivery discipline to ensure successful implementation of complex initiatives in the electric, gas, or water utility sectors. This position requires strong strategic leadership alongside program execution oversight, especially for GIS and utility transformation initiatives by performing the following duties.
- Translate utility business strategies into enterprise decisions and requirements that align solutions with GIS and operational objectives.
- Contribute to the design of current and future state architecture with a focus on geospatial systems, enterprise data flows, and business process optimization.
- Develop architectural blueprints, capability models, and data flow diagrams to guide solution design and delivery.
- Act as a thought leader in spatial data management, utility network modeling, and digital grid initiatives.
- Build and drive relationships with key partners to ensure effective project execution, including strategic, delivery, and tactical decisions.
- Serves as a mentor to project resources. Coaches and manages resources and actively participates in the performance expectation process.
- Lead end-to-end delivery of enterprise-wide GIS and utility transformation programs, ensuring alignment with business goals, timelines, and budgets.
- Manage cross-functional teams of architects, developers, analysts, and third-party vendors.
- Work with PMO to track and build program plans, resource allocations, budgets, and risk registers.
- Facilitate stakeholder engagement, including executive steering committees, to ensure buy-in, transparency, and successful change management.
- Act as the main point of contact for executive sponsors, business leaders, and technical teams.
- Facilitate workshops, steering committees, and status reporting to ensure transparency, alignment, and issue resolution.
- Support organizational change management, training, and communication strategies to drive user adoption and minimize disruption.

- Bachelor's degree and Master’s degree in related discipline (e.g., Information Technology, Computer Science, Systems Engineering, Software Engineering, Electric Engineering, Mechanical/Civil Engineering or equivalent), or equivalent utility and consulting work experience.
- 10+ years of experience in technical or enterprise architecture in theutility industry
(electric, gas, or water).
- 5+ years of experience in program or project management delivering large-scale, cross-functional utility/GIS initiatives.- Proven experience with
GIS platforms
such as
Esri ArcGIS Enterprise
,
GE Smallworld
, or
Hexagon
.
- Experience integrating GIS with utility systems such as CIS, OMS, SCADA, or ERP platforms (e.g., SAP, Oracle).
- Demonstrated success leading IT transformation, grid modernization, or advanced asset/data management programs.
- Deep understanding of spatial data models, utility network modeling (UNM), and asset lifecycle management.
- Familiarity with cloud-based GIS and IT architectures (Azure, AWS, Esri Cloud).
- Proficiency in architecture modeling tools (e.g., Sparx EA, ArchiMate, Visio) and project management tools (e.g., MS Project, JIRA, Smartsheet).
- Knowledge of Agile, Waterfall, and hybrid delivery methodologies.
